The rain fell heavily when the clouds thickened and darkened.

That's an example of one.

The independent clause is The rain fell heavily. Those 4 words will stand by themselves as a complete thought. The dependent clause is when the clouds thickened and darkened.  

The dependent clause tells you when it rains heavily. It will not stand on its own.
